SAICI launches The Vanguard 7 with first two members

The Society for AI in Competitive Intelligence has launched The Vanguard 7, a standing advisory council meant to shape AI-native competitive intelligence standards, training, and professional development. Jem Cuffee and Rose Beverly are the first inaugural members, with five more appointments expected in the coming months.

Why it matters: - The Society for AI in Competitive Intelligence is trying to define how competitive intelligence works as AI-native tools, agents, and workflows become standard. - The new council will help shape standards, credentialing, and professional development for the field. - SAICI is also using the council to influence the future direction of the organization itself.

What happened: - SAICI announced The Vanguard 7 on July 22, 2026. - The council is a hand-selected advisory body of practitioners, researchers, and operators. - Jem Cuffee and Rose Beverly are the first two inaugural members. - SAICI is a microsociety of the American Institute of Artificial Intelligence.

The details: - The Vanguard 7 will advise SAICI on how AI is changing competitive intelligence production. - The council will also weigh in on how practitioners should be trained and credentialed for an AI-native era. - SAICI says the profession is changing as agentic systems, generative tools, and AI-augmented workflows become the operating reality of modern CI. - Members are selected for working at the leading edge of the discipline, not for commenting on it from the sidelines. - Cuffee is a founding member of SAICI and Senior Principal Engineer at Dell Technologies. - Cuffee works across AI/ML, cloud, and infrastructure, and partners with product, marketing, and sales on competitive strategy. - Cuffee previously held roles at JPMorgan Chase in disruptive technology, software development, and economics. - SAICI says Cuffee represents the engineering perspective needed for AI-native CI. - Beverly is a Senior Competitive Intelligence Analyst at CrowdStrike. - Beverly focuses on AI for cybersecurity, competitive strategy, and emerging technologies affecting security markets. - Beverly studied anthropology, psychology, and philosophy at UC Berkeley. - Beverly spent nearly a decade in user experience research, innovation, and strategy at PayPal, MasterClass, and Silicon Valley Bank. - Beverly developed M.A.S.T.E.R., a cross-functional AI adoption framework now used across more than 30 organizations. - SAICI says Beverly brings the human-AI fluency needed to make intelligence usable inside organizations. - The two inaugural members represent engineering depth and human-AI fluency. - SAICI plans to name five additional Vanguard 7 members in the coming months. - SAICI also pointed professionals to saici.ai for more information on The Vanguard 7, SAICI, and the CGENAI® in Competitive Intelligence certification. - SAICI describes itself as a professional society focused on standards, certification, professional development, and community for competitive intelligence. - SAICI says its work is aimed at strengthening intelligence capability in an environment shaped by artificial intelligence and rising strategic demands.

Between the lines: - SAICI is signaling that AI-native competitive intelligence needs both technical engineering depth and organizational judgment. - The choice of one engineer and one practitioner focused on applied AI suggests the council is meant to be operational, not academic. - The emphasis on standards and certification points to an effort to formalize a field that is still being reshaped by AI.

What's next: - SAICI will add five more members to The Vanguard 7 over the next few months. - The full founding cohort is expected to help set professional standards and define credible AI-native CI practice. - Interest in the council and certification is being directed to saici.ai. - SAICI's LinkedIn page is available at American Institute of AI on LinkedIn.
